Specifications

The followings are basic parameters of the part selected concerning the characteristics of the part and categories it belongs to.

Product Category MOSFET RoHS Details
Technology Si Mounting Style SMD/SMT
Package / Case SOT-23-3 Transistor Polarity P-Channel
Number of Channels 1 Channel Vds - Drain-Source Breakdown Voltage 20 V
Id - Continuous Drain Current 2.4 A Rds On - Drain-Source Resistance 160 mOhms
Vgs - Gate-Source Voltage - 12 V, + 12 V Vgs th - Gate-Source Threshold Voltage 300 mV
Qg - Gate Charge 3.4 nC Minimum Operating Temperature - 55 C
Maximum Operating Temperature + 150 C Pd - Power Dissipation 1.4 W
Channel Mode Enhancement Brand Diodes Incorporated
Configuration Single Fall Time 10.5 ns
Product Type MOSFET Rise Time 7.4 ns
Factory Pack Quantity 3000 Subcategory MOSFETs
Transistor Type 1 P-Channel Typical Turn-Off Delay Time 11 ns
Typical Turn-On Delay Time 3.2 ns Unit Weight 0.000282 oz
